Factors to consider for Senior citizens



While dental implants provide numerous advantages, there are very important factors to consider seniors need to keep in mind before proceeding with this alternative.

Initially, your total wellness plays a crucial function. diamonds dentist like diabetic issues, osteoporosis, or heart issues can impact recovery and make complex the procedure. It's important to consult with your healthcare provider to ensure you're an appropriate candidate.



Next off, consider the cost. Oral implants can be costly, and insurance policy protection varies. Make sure you recognize your financial obligations and explore payment options if needed.

Furthermore, think of your dental hygiene routine. Implants need thorough care to protect against infection and make certain durability.

One more variable is the moment commitment included. The process can take several months from appointment to last positioning, so you'll require to prepare as necessary.

Finally, review your lifestyle. If you have mobility issues or find it tough to go to follow-up visits, oral implants may not be the most effective selection for you.

The Implant Treatment Process



Comprehending the implant procedure process is essential for elders considering this oral choice. The journey commonly starts with an appointment where your dental expert examines your oral health and discusses your objectives. They may take X-rays or scans to ensure you're an ideal prospect for implants.

As soon as you're approved, the primary step of the treatment includes placing the titanium dental implant into your jawbone. This is done under neighborhood anesthesia, so you will not feel discomfort throughout the procedure.

After the dental implant is positioned, it's vital to enable a recovery duration of a few months. During this time around, the dental implant merges with your bone-- a process referred to as osseointegration.

After recovery, you'll go back to the dentist to affix an abutment, which functions as an adapter in between the dental implant and the crown. Once the abutment is secured, perceptions of your mouth will be taken to create a custom crown that matches your all-natural teeth.

Ultimately, when your crown prepares, your dentist will affix it to the abutment. The whole procedure may take numerous months, however the result is a sturdy, natural-looking tooth that can substantially improve your quality of life.
